Requirements
- Target platform
- OpenClaw
- Install method
- Manual import
- Extraction
- Extract archive
- Prerequisites
- OpenClaw
- Primary doc
- SKILL.md
Troubleshoot GitHub Actions workflows, particularly for Go projects. Diagnose failing workflows, distinguish between code and environment issues, interpret logs, and apply fixes for common CI/CD problems.
Troubleshoot GitHub Actions workflows, particularly for Go projects. Diagnose failing workflows, distinguish between code and environment issues, interpret logs, and apply fixes for common CI/CD problems.
Hand the extracted package to your coding agent with a concrete install brief instead of figuring it out manually.
I downloaded a skill package from Yavira. Read SKILL.md from the extracted folder and install it by following the included instructions. Tell me what you changed and call out any manual steps you could not complete.
I downloaded an updated skill package from Yavira. Read SKILL.md from the extracted folder, compare it with my current installation, and upgrade it while preserving any custom configuration unless the package docs explicitly say otherwise. Summarize what changed and any follow-up checks I should run.
Use the gh CLI and Git to diagnose and fix GitHub Actions workflow failures, particularly for Go projects. This skill helps identify whether failures are due to code issues or environment/configuration problems.
Check the status of recent workflow runs: gh run list --repo owner/repo --limit 10 View details of a specific failing workflow: gh run view <run-id> --repo owner/repo Get logs for failed jobs only: gh run view <run-id> --repo owner/repo --log-failed
Code Issues: Failures in compilation, tests, or linting that occur consistently across environments Environment Issues: Problems with dependency resolution, tool installation, or type-checking in CI that work locally
Look for "undefined" reference errors that indicate import resolution problems Try minimal linter configs that disable type-checking linters Use golangci-lint run --disable-all --enable=gofmt for basic syntax checking
Verify go.mod and go.sum are consistent Run go mod tidy to resolve dependency conflicts Check that required dependencies are properly declared
Check specific workflow job logs: gh run view --job <job-id> --repo owner/repo Download workflow artifacts for inspection: gh run download <run-id> --repo owner/repo
Identify which jobs are failing and which are passing Examine error messages for clues about the nature of the issue Determine if the issue is reproducible locally Apply targeted fixes based on issue type Monitor subsequent workflow runs to verify resolution
Code helpers, APIs, CLIs, browser automation, testing, and developer operations.
Largest current source with strong distribution and engagement signals.